## Step 4 — Turn on snapshot testing for Wrenkit components

Alright, reviewer hat on: this step swaps our old pixel-diff checks for serialized snapshots. Run the suite once to generate baselines, then eyeball the diffs before approving — stale baselines are the classic footgun here. Dynamic props like timestamps get masked automatically now, so fewer flaky failures. The snapshot runner ships with the following defaults.

service settings:
[quenath]
host = quenath.zemvarcorp.corp
user = quenath_svc
database = quenath_prod

## Local Setup: Broker Upgrade Dry Run

Before you roll the Mallowgate broker upgrade to staging, do a dry run locally. Spin up the old broker version with `make broker-old`, replay a day of traffic from the fixtures, then swap in the new version and diff the delivery logs. The replay tool stores its checkpoints in Postgres, so point it at the connection string below.

primary connection of yagep-kahip = redis://giliel_svc:zYiKsLL2PLpfPL@db-348f.xolmarsys.corp:5432/fenwyn

## Ownership

The clock-skew monitor for the Quarrylight build farm lives in this repo. Build agents occasionally drift more than the 250ms tolerance, which breaks artifact timestamp ordering and causes the Slatebird scheduler to mark runs as flaky. If support sees skew alerts, first check the NTP sidecar logs, then escalate rather than restarting agents manually — restarts mask the drift without fixing it. Questions about the monitor, its thresholds, or the escalation path go to the component owner listed below.

account owner for kagag-yahap: Novath Quenok

Action item from the Mirewater tide-table widget incident. Owner: release manager. Widget cached stale harbor offsets after the DST change, showing tides six hours off for two days. Required: add a cache-invalidation check to the release checklist, block deploys when offset tables are older than 24 hours, and verify the Saltgate harbor feed before each cut. Deadline: next release. Checklist template and sign-off procedure are documented on the internal page below.

wiki page, kawif-bajep: https://artifactory.zarqelforge.internal/issue/browse/display/display/projects/spaces/secrets/000fe6ec5a46af29355003e1